Which contract is created by the conduct of the parties?

Implied contract.
An Implied contract is created by the conduct of the parties.

Implied contracts are based on the actions of those involved. Implied contracts can be implied-in-fact or implied-in-law.

It is important to differentiate between implied and express contracts. Express contracts require explicitly stated terms, either orally or written, whereas implied contracts are recognized through the conduct of the parties.
